Warning Signs You Need Basement Water Removal

Catching the signs of water damage early can save you thousands of dollars in repairs and prevent further damage to your property. Here are some common warning signs to look out for:

Musty Odors That Won’t Go Away

Strong, unpleasant odors can be a sign of mold growth, which can lead to serious health problems. If you notice persistent musty smells in your basement, it’s time to call our team.

Water Stains on Walls and Ceilings

Water stains can be a sign of a larger issue, such as a leaky pipe or a damaged roof. If you notice water stains on your walls or ceilings, don’t ignore them, call our team to assess the damage.

Warped or Buckled Flooring

Warped or buckled flooring can be a sign of water damage, which can lead to further issues if left unchecked. If you notice your flooring is damaged, contact our team to assess the situation.

Basement Water Removal Cost In Towne Lake, TX

The cost of Basement Water Removal can vary depending on the severity of the damage, the size of the affected area, and local conditions in Towne Lake, TX. Here are some estimated price ranges for common Basement Water Removal services:

ServiceTypical Price RangeWhat Affects Cost
Water Removal$500 – $2,500Size of affected area, severity of damage
Drying and Dehumidification$200 – $1,000Size of affected area, type of equipment used
Repair and Reconstruction$1,000 – $5,000Size of affected area, type of materials used
Dehumidification and Ventilation$100 – $500Size of affected area, type of equipment used
Water Damage Inspection$100 – $300Size of affected area, type of equipment used
Moisture Testing and Removal$200 – $1,000Size of affected area, type of equipment used

Common Questions About Basement Water Removal

Q: Will I need to replace my entire basement?

A: Not always. Our team will assess the damage and recommend repairs or reconstruction as needed. In many cases, we can salvage and restore your existing basement, saving you time and money.

Q: How long will it take to dry my basement?

A: The drying process can take anywhere from 3-5 days, depending on the severity of the damage and the size of the affected area. Our team will work with you to create a customized plan and provide regular updates on the drying process.
